Forename Hort

Around the world, Hort (Hort Czechia Brazil Germany Switzerland United States, Хорт Ukraine Russia Belarus Kazakhstan Kyrgyzstan, Горт Ukraine Russia Kazakhstan Kyrgyzstan) is a rare gender-neutral given name. The first name Hort is characteristic of Romania, where it is a rare male name, the Democratic Republic of the Congo, where it is a rare girly name, and China, where it is an extremely rare male name. More frequently, Hort is the last name as well as the forename.
